### Token System

The UI uses a token-based formatting system for dynamic styling. Tokens are placeholder strings embedded in text that get expanded to ANSI escape codes via `zstr_expand_tokens()` in `src/utils.c`. This allows formatting to be defined declaratively without hardcoding ANSI sequences throughout the codebase.
The UI uses a stack-based token formatting system implemented with [Ragel](https://www.colm.net/open-source/ragel/). Tokens are placeholder strings embedded in text that get expanded to ANSI escape codes via `zstr_expand_tokens()`. This allows formatting to be defined declaratively without hardcoding ANSI sequences throughout the codebase.

**Implementation**: `src/tokens.rl` (Ragel source) generates `src/tokens.c`

**Documentation**: See `spec/token_system.md` for complete token specifications and usage patterns.

**Stack Semantics**: Each style token pushes its previous state onto a stack. `{/}` pops one level, restoring the previous state. This enables proper nesting of styles.

**Key Features:**
- **Deferred Emission**: ANSI codes only emit when an actual character is printed
- **Redundancy Avoidance**: Repeated identical styles don't emit duplicate codes
- **Auto-Reset at Newlines**: All styles automatically reset before each newline

| Category | Tokens |
|----------|--------|
| **Semantic** | `{b}` (bold), `{highlight}` (bold+yellow), `{h1}` (bold+orange), `{h2}` (bold+blue), `{dim}` (gray), `{section}` (bold), `{danger}` (red bg) |
| **Attributes** | `{bold}` `{B}`, `{italic}` `{I}`, `{underline}` `{U}`, `{reverse}`, `{strikethrough}`, `{strike}` |
| **Colors** | `{red}`, `{green}`, `{blue}`, `{yellow}`, `{cyan}`, `{magenta}`, `{white}`, `{black}`, `{gray}`/`{grey}` |
| **Bright Colors** | `{bright:red}`, `{bright:green}`, etc. |
| **256-Color** | `{fg:N}`, `{bg:N}` where N is 0-255 |
| **Background** | `{bg:red}`, `{bg:green}`, etc. |
| **Reset/Pop** | `{/}` (pop), `{/name}` (e.g., `{/highlight}`), `{reset}` (full reset), `{/fg}`, `{/bg}` |
| **Control** | `{clr}` (clear line), `{cls}` (clear screen), `{home}`, `{hide}`, `{show}` |
| **Special** | `{cursor}` (cursor position tracking) |
